John Lowell (actor)


John Lowell was an American film actor who starred in several productions during the silent era. He is sometimes credited as John Lowell Russell.

Biography

Lowell was born in Pleasant [Valley Township, Scott County, Iowa|Pleasant Valley, Iowa]. He was married to the screenwriter Lillian Case Russell. The actress Evangeline Russell and the cinematographer John L. Russell were their children.
Lowell began his film career in 1919, appearing in two shorts. He was a producer for Lowell Film Productions, whose work included Red Love.
On September 19, 1937, Lowell died in Los Angeles, California.
